High temperatures, moist air and a week of showers will set Tauranga up for some muggy conditions this week.
MetService meteorologist Andy Best said the area can expect a week of showers that will turn to rain later in the week.
Moist air combined with temperatures around 23 to 25Cwill likely create "subtropical" conditions for the area, he said.
Tauranga residents can also expect some warm and sticky nights with overnight temperatures sitting around 16 and 18C.

The city will see cloudy conditions today with a few showers here and there.
Winds will pick up this afternoon with a high of 23C.
Northerly winds have created similar airflow around the Bay of Plenty region meaning most of the area will experience cloud cover and showers throughout the week.
The week ahead:
Today: Cloudy with the odd shower. 23 degree high, 17 degrees overnight. Tomorrow: Cloudy with a few showers. 24 degree high, 18 degrees overnight. Wednesday: Cloud increasing, showers. 25 degree high, 17 degrees overnight. Thursday: Cloudy with rain at times. 23 degree high, 16 degrees overnight. Friday: Cloudy, occasional rain. 23 degree high, 16 degrees overnight.
